September Special Events Abroad

The Ithaca College Wind Ensemble, with guest conductor Rodney Winther, has been invited to participate in the British Association of Symphonic Bands and Wind Ensembles Convention in Canterbury this fall. The wind ensemble will also be performing at the London Center, the Royal Academy of Music in London, and the University of Limerick in Ireland.
